CLEVELAND HEIGHTS, Ohio - Cleveland Heights firefighters battle a house fire on Clifford Road just after 1 a.m. Tuesday.
According to a family friend, the fire started when a cat knocked over a candle onto an oxygen system that was in use.
The two people inside the home were able to get out of the home uninjured, according to the family friend.
